Both breeds can fade and change color from pup to adulthood. Both breeds also have a … fish paste woolworthsWebLike many other doodles, a Sheepadoodle may and does change colour. This is especially apparent in Sheepadoddles, which have black and dark brown coats that gradually fade to grey and white as they mature. As they approach maturity, the fading usually happens between the ages of 6 and 12 months. fish paste spread recipeWebAt what age did you start noticing your pup graying out? 1 4 4 Comments Best Add a Comment brokejetflyer • 2 yr. ago We noticed gray around the eyes at 9 weeks old when we first got him.
